Interesting story about this song. It began 34 prior (in 1985 [!!!]) when this track was part of the original Cassette-Album configuration for Lawrence Wise And The Cosmic Funk Orchestra's "Edge Of A Dream". It was supposed to close out the album (right after the 20+ minute "Cosmic Dreams"). Looking back, it didn't seem to fit--even though the matching "Castle Sinn (Electric Torture)" did (on Side-One of the original album).

I wound up dropping it from the CD Transfer Master in 2002--mainly because of lack of CD space (thanks mainly to "Cosmic Dreams"), only to upload it to SoundClick under the "OSMOSIS"-banner in 2008 as a single track.

So, technically, "Horror Rap" was an "orphaned" track. I even made a Cassette-Single edit of it in '85 (with--believe it or not!!--a raw, original version of "Lesbian Tendencies"...later re-recorded in 1990). THIS Single edit follows the original one, but is a bit longer because I decided to leave the middle keyboard-break in...and it flows better because of it.

AND, after sitting for 33 Years (at the time---2018), "Horror Rap" makes it's official debut as part of the OSMOSIS Album, "MR. LOU C. FER"...effectively closing that album out.

NOW--ABOUT THE SONG ITSELF:

It's exactly what it says in the title.

A pair of crazy Zombies ("Fred, from the Living Dead" and "Cool, the Half-Dead Fool") are dropping horror-based rhymes, talking some serious trash. Near the end of the album version (after a wild 'scat'-breakdown), the rapping is thrown out the window, as we get a 'comedy-skit' with our MC's feasting on some poor sucker who just happened to come by...even feeding ONE PART OF HIM To Their (Zombie) DOG!! (Don't even ask!!).

Originally a "Lawrence Wise And The Cosmic Funk Orchestra" track, it sounded "OSMOSIS", before I started calling myself that name in 1989.
